## Support

Clock skew between Forgeline build agents causes cache invalidation and flaky signature checks. Agents sync via the internal Ticktower NTP pool; skew over 2 seconds fails the preflight check. Before filing anything: restart the agent's time daemon, re-run preflight, and capture the skew report. Known-bad agents are listed in the infra wiki. Bring unresolved cases to the weekly eng sync, or for anything blocking a release, email the build infra team at the address below.

alerts address for bawif-hahig: norwyn_gorys_lamath@olvarqlabs.test

Handover — Chirpline log sampling. Welcome aboard. Chirpline emits roughly 40k lines/min, so we sample at 1% in prod via the Tapwick agent; error-level lines bypass sampling entirely. Don't raise the rate without checking Fennel cluster disk headroom first — last time it filled in six hours. Sampling config lives in the ops vault under the chirpline namespace. To unlock that vault entry if my session expires, you'll need the recovery passphrase below.

recovery phrase for fajep-yaweg: gilath-sorox-wenius-rusdor-keliel-zorius

### Capacity: Stockmarrow reconciliation job

Nightly reconciliation walks the full SKU ledger and diffs against warehouse counts. Runtime grows linearly with SKU count; at current growth we hit the 4-hour batch window in roughly ten months. Shard by warehouse before then. Memory is bounded by the diff buffer, which flushes at a fixed row count. Do not raise parallelism past the DB pool size. Current constants are below.

tuning constants:
WEIGHTS = {
    "kasion": 449,
    "julax": 314,
    "novdor": 823,
    "ralmir": 390,
    "novael": 220,
}

Ticket #— Floor 9 Opening Prep, Brindlemoor House

Hi facilities folks, Floor 9 opens to staff next Monday and we need a few things squared away before then. Lift access is live, but the two side doors by the kitchenette are still on the old lock config — please reprogram them before Friday. Also, signage for the quiet rooms hasn't arrived, so pop up the temporary printed ones for now. Until the badge readers sync, the interim door code for Floor 9 is below.

door code, bajop-bajog: bdg-DSWAC-43621